| + | == Function == | ||
| + | [https://www.uniprot.org/uniprot/ST2A1_HUMAN ST2A1_HUMAN] Sulfotransferase that utilizes 3'-phospho-5'-adenylyl sulfate (PAPS) as sulfonate donor to catalyze the sulfonation of steroids and bile acids in the liver and adrenal glands. | ||
